Water vapor at 4.0 MPa and 400C enters an insulated turbine operating at steady state and expands to saturated vapor at 0.1 MPa. The effects of motion and gravity can be neglected. Determine the work developed and the exergy destruction, each in kJ per kg of water vapor passing through the turbine. Let T0 = 27 C, Po = 0.1 MPa
